COOLIDGE,  Calvin. ADDRESS OF PRESIDENT COOLIDGE TO  THE  NATIONAL
REPUBLICAN  COMMITTEE AT THE WHITE HOUSE DECEMBER 6, 1927. Washington:
U.S.  Gov. Printing Office 1929. First Edition. Small octavo (5-1/2" x
7-1/2")  bound  in flexible blue morocco lettered in  gilt  (including
Coolidge's  name at the bottom right) and decorated in gilt with stars
in  the corners and the Presidential coat-of-arms in the center.  With
a  printed  title page but the 19 text pages mimeographed rather  than
printed  on  paper with three holes in the gutter margin.  Obviously a
very  limited  production likely printed for Coolidge's personal  use,
and  quite  possibly unique. OCLC does not record any printed copy  of
this  speech  though it lists about 70 others. Given the same  day  as
the  1927 State of the Union address, this speech was given to a  much
smaller,  more selective audience. In the audience was William Butler,
a  Massachusetts  Senator who was Coolidge's campaign manager and  the
Republican  Party  Chairman.  This is his copy and  is  INSCRIBED  and
SIGNED  to him by the President two days before Coolidge left  office:
"To    Honorable  William  M.  Butler,/In   appreciation  of  a   long
and/faithful  friendship/  Calvin Coolidge,/The  White  House,/March 1
1929."  In  the  third sentence of his  speech  Coolidge  acknowledges
Butler:  "Both  the primary and the election were under the  immediate
direction  of  the  present  Chairman,  William  M.  Butler."  In  his
AUTOBIOGRAPHY,  Coolidge  remarks:  "The  campaign  was  magnificently
managed  by  William  M. Butler." Two minor text corrections  in  ink,
likely  by Coolidge. Remarkable association, fairly equivalent to Karl
Rove's  copy  of a speech of gratitude inscribed to him by  George  W.
Bush.  Fine  and  exceptionally scarce item with  superb  association.
